THE RECIPE 2oz. 504Hibiscus Rum 1oz. Lime juice 1oz. Jalapeño syrup 2 sprigs fresh mint Add rum, lime juice, syrup and leaves from 1 sprig of mint to a shaker with ice. Shake vigorously. Strain over ice. Garnish with 1 sprig mint. THE STORY
It's no secret that we love creating cocktails with ingredients grown right here on our patio. (Learn more about growing your own cocktail garden here!) The Hibiscus Jalapeño Mojito is a variation on one of our classics - the Hibiscus Mojito - and uses multiple ingredients from our distillery cocktail garden. We love the pairing of the sweet, sour, spicy and minty - it's an explosion of sensations with every sip, bursting with flavor and feeling. We bring this cocktail out on weekends when our jalapeño plants are providing an abundant harvest, or when the occasion requires a little bit of spice.
